Default DRL Bypass/Disable Harness

Has anyone ever used this before? The only way that I have found to disable the DRL lights is to take out the DRL relay under the hood but the service engine soon light comes on and I hate that.
If you have used it, is it hard to install? Are there detail instructions on how to install it? Any help would be appreciated.... Thank you.

What year is it? Because if it's a 2004 or 2005, the SES light shouldn't come on if you do that. On 2004 MCs, I think you can remove the relay and you shouldn't get a SES light. I know for sure that you can do it on 2005 models. 2006 and 2007 I believe have an entirely different setup when it comes to the DRLs.

I have 2005 Monte carlo SS supercharged , I cut off pin 87 from the daytime running lights relay. No SES light came on , auto headlights still work. It's been like that for over 18 months now no problems..

For 2005, you can do the Pin 87 trick as the DRLs are the low beams and are not monitored by the BCM

For 2000-2004, the Pin 87 trick doesn't work since the BCM is looking to see if the high beams are indeed lit when it commands the DRLs on. You will get a "Highbeam Out" in the message center. If you remove the DRL relay, you will get a "Service Vehicle Soon" in the message center

The DRL/ALC bypass is very easy to install... Instructions are here:

Also, for 2005 Montes, the low beam headlights double as the DRLs. That might be why I can remove the whole relay, disable the DRLs, and still have the automatic headlights with no SES light. The Pin 87 trick should work also, but I've yet to try it.

It should work on the LT and the SS as well. Different powertrains, but essentially the same wiring harnesses.
